Orthopedic Surgical Planning Software Market To witness Huge Expansion By 2030


Orthopedic Surgical Planning Software Market Summary

The global orthopedic surgical planning software market was valued at USD 65.60 million in 2022 and is projected to reach USD 106.82 million by 2030, growing at a compound annual growth rate (CAGR) of 6.36% from 2023 to 2030. This market growth is primarily driven by continuous advancements in orthopedic surgical planning technologies. The growing awareness among healthcare professionals and institutions about the clinical benefits and operational efficiency offered by such software solutions is further encouraging their adoption in surgical environments, particularly for improving accuracy and enhancing patient outcomes in orthopedic procedures.

The COVID-19 pandemic had a mixed impact on the medical industry. While some sectors experienced a slowdown, others witnessed growth. In the early stages of the pandemic, the global healthcare system faced immense pressure, prompting many governments to postpone non-essential surgical procedures. This shift was necessary to allocate medical resources and personnel to the treatment of COVID-19 patients. As a result, hospital visits declined, and a significant number of elective surgeries were canceled. For instance, in 2021, nearly 10 million people in the United Kingdom were waiting for surgical procedures, compared to 4 million prior to the pandemic.

Key Market Trends & Insights

  • Based on type, the market is segmented into pre-operative and post-operative planning software. The pre-operative segment held the largest revenue share of 76.4% in 2022 and is expected to grow at the fastest CAGR of 6.9% throughout the forecast period. This growth is largely attributed to the increasing awareness about the advantages of pre-operative planning, which include better surgical outcomes, reduced intraoperative complications, and enhanced resource planning within surgical teams.
  • By delivery mode, the market is categorized into cloud-based and on-premise solutions. The cloud-based segment dominated the market with a revenue share of 64.5% in 2022 and is anticipated to register the fastest CAGR of 6.6% over the forecast period. This dominance is due to the enhanced capabilities of cloud-based platforms, which offer flexible access to computing resources, scalable storage for planning applications, and real-time data synchronization—key advantages that are driving adoption among orthopedic surgeons and healthcare institutions.
  • In terms of end-use, the market is segmented into hospitals and orthopedic clinics. The hospital segment led the market in 2022, accounting for 51.5% of the revenue share. It is also projected to experience the fastest CAGR of 5.8% from 2023 to 2030. This trend is attributed to the increasing use of orthopedic surgical planning software by hospital-based healthcare providers who seek to improve surgical precision, standardize procedures, and enhance operational performance across departments.
  • Geographically, North America held the largest share of the global orthopedic surgical planning software market in 2022, contributing 40.5% of the total revenue. This growth is supported by the presence of well-developed healthcare systems, ongoing technological innovations, and the widespread adoption of digital tools in surgical practices across the region.
  • The Asia Pacific region is expected to record the fastest CAGR of 7.3% over the forecast period. The region's rapid growth can be linked to the increasing elderly population, rising incidence of orthopedic conditions, and growing advancements in surgical technologies. Additionally, many Asian countries are investing in digital health infrastructure, which supports the integration of advanced planning tools into orthopedic care.

Key Companies & Market Share Insights

The key players are participating in strategic initiatives, such as partnerships, acquisitions, expansions, and collaboration, to increase their market share. For instance, in October 2022, Brainlab announced a partnership with the German Society for Orthopedics and Orthopedic Surgery. The partnership is aimed at advancements in the area of data privacy-compliant registry solutions.

Moreover, in February 2022, Formus Labs raised USD 5 million for product development and expansion in the U.S. market. Punakaiki Fund, Pacific Channel, Flying Kiwis, and Icehouse Ventures are the participants in this investment. Furthermore, in February 2022, Formus Labs announced a partnership with Zimmer Biomet. The goal of this partnership is to co-develop and commercialize Formus Hip in New Zealand and Australia.
